#1b0b16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b0b16 is composed of 10.6% red, 4.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 18.5% yellow and 89.4%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 7.5%. #1b0b16 color hex could be obtained by blending #36162c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#1b0b16 color description : Very dark (mostly black) pink.
#1b0b16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b0b16 has RGB values of R:27, G:11,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.19, K:0.89. Its decimal value is 1772310.
